I'm using Linux Tools Project coverage plugin and I'm able to look at coverage data.
When I re-run my test, is there a way to refresh the coverage data? The only way I found is to delete the .gcda file and re-run the test.
Any clue?

Hi,
You're right:
By default, gcov accumulates data in gcda files.
If you want to clean coverage data, you have to delete these file and re-run the test.
